Best Sherman Public Schools (2024)

For the 2024 school year, there is 1 public school serving 567 students in Sherman, IL.
The top ranked public school in Sherman, IL is Sherman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Sherman, IL public school have an average math proficiency score of 53% (versus the Illinois public school average of 26%), and reading proficiency score of 53% (versus the 31% statewide average). Schools in Sherman have an average ranking of 10/10, which is in the top 5% of Illinois public schools.
Minority enrollment is 6%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Black), which is less than the Illinois public school average of 53% (majority Hispanic).
